ENZYME entry: EC 1.14.13.33
Accepted Name |
4-hydroxybenzoate 3-monooxygenase [NAD(P)H].
|
Alternative Name(s) |
4-hydroxybenzoate 3-hydroxylase. |
Reaction catalysed |
- 4-hydroxybenzoate + H(+) + NADH + O2 <=> 3,4-dihydroxybenzoate + H2O + NAD(+)
- 4-hydroxybenzoate + H(+) + NADPH + O2 <=> 3,4-dihydroxybenzoate + H2O + NADP(+)
|
Comment(s) |
- The enzyme from Corynebacterium cyclohexanicum is highly specific for
4-hydroxybenzoate, but uses NADH and NADPH at approximately equal
rates (cf. EC 1.14.13.2).
- It is less specific for NADPH than EC 1.14.13.2.
